There are certain facts which you must clear before purchasing toy bones for your pet friends;

• Size - toy bones should be large enough so that the dogs are unable to swallow it.
• Safety - it should be safe enough for your delicate doggies.
• Design - design should obviously attract your dogs.
• Durability - this is the most important quality that you must seek; it should last long
• Washable - toy bones should be such that they can be maintained clean and safe for the dogs. They should be washable and thus maintainable.
• Robust - toys should be strong enough to resist the rough handling of your dogs.
• Preference of your dogs - being your true friend, you can very well distinguish the kind of toys your dogs like.
• Easy to handle - they should be light and convenient to carry around
